Best cycling routes Baie-Saint-Paul are found where the St. Lawrence River meets the Charlevoix mountains, creating a varied terrain for touring cyclists. The region features significant elevation changes, riverfront paths, and routes that venture inland through rugged landscapes. This blend of river and mountain vistas offers diverse options for cycling.

Best touring cycling routes around Baie-Saint-Paul

  • The most popular touring cycling route is Rivière du Gouffre loop from Baie Saint Paul, a 38.7 miles (62.3 km) trail that takes 4 hours 6 minutes to complete. This route offers views of the Gouffre River and surrounding mountains.
  • Another top favourite among local touring cyclists is Belvédère de la Vigie loop from Baie Saint Paul, a difficult 22.3 miles (35.8 km) path. This route includes challenging climbs and panoramic viewpoints over the bay.
  • Local touring cyclists also love the Bras du Nord-Ouest loop from Baie Saint Paul, a 21.2 miles (34.2 km) trail leading through varied terrain with significant elevation, often completed in about 2 hours 33 minutes.
  • Touring cycling around Baie-Saint-Paul is defined by the St. Lawrence River, Charlevoix mountains, and the Gouffre River valley. The network offers options for different ability levels, from challenging mountain ascents to more moderate riverside paths.

Frequently Asked Questions

What kind of terrain can I expect when touring cycling in Baie-Saint-Paul?

Baie-Saint-Paul offers a diverse landscape where the St. Lawrence River meets the Charlevoix mountains. You'll find routes with significant elevation changes, challenging climbs, and panoramic views of the vast St. Lawrence River. There are also more serene countryside paths and routes along the Gouffre River.

Are there any easy touring cycling routes suitable for beginners or families?

While many routes in the region feature significant elevation, there are options for less experienced cyclists. The town itself offers simple bike paths to explore magnificent landscapes. For a shorter, less demanding ride, consider the Grinduro! Feed Zone #3 loop from Écomusée du fromage, which is just over 8 km long.

What are some challenging touring cycling routes in Baie-Saint-Paul?

For experienced cyclists seeking a challenge, Baie-Saint-Paul offers several demanding routes. The Rivière du Gouffre loop from Baie Saint Paul is a difficult 62.3 km route with over 800 meters of elevation gain. Another challenging option is the Belvédère de la Vigie loop from Baie Saint Paul, which covers 35.8 km with over 550 meters of ascent and offers panoramic viewpoints.

Are there any circular touring cycling routes in the area?

Yes, many of the touring cycling routes around Baie-Saint-Paul are designed as loops, allowing you to start and end in the same location. Examples include the Bras du Nord-Ouest loop from Baie Saint Paul and the Rivière du Gouffre loop from Baie Saint Paul.

What can I see along the touring cycling routes in Baie-Saint-Paul?

Cyclists can enjoy extraordinary views of the St. Lawrence River, the Charlevoix mountains, and the Gouffre River. Routes often pass through charming villages, offer glimpses of the maritime landscape, and provide access to cultural stops within Baie-Saint-Paul itself, such as art galleries and bistros. The Belvédère de Baie-Saint-Paul offers a magnificent panoramic view of the bay and Isle-aux-Coudres.

Are there opportunities for agrotourism or local food experiences along the routes?

Yes, the Charlevoix region is known for its agrotourism. Cyclists can follow the Charlevoix Flavour Trail to experience local flavors, meet producers, and sample traditional expertise, with stops for cheeses, charcuterie meats, and other local products. This offers a delightful culinary dimension to your cycling tour.

What is the best time of year for touring cycling in Baie-Saint-Paul?

The region is generally best enjoyed for cycling during the warmer months, typically from late spring to early autumn. This period offers pleasant weather conditions and ensures that all routes and attractions are fully accessible. Always check local weather forecasts before heading out.

Where can I find parking or access points for the touring cycling routes?

Baie-Saint-Paul offers various access points. Many routes can be started directly from the town, which has parking facilities. The Parc du Gouffre is another potential starting point, offering dirt trails along the river. For exploring the town itself, cycling from Bas-de-la-Baie to the beach and downtown is a great way to discover its unique attractions.

Can I combine cycling with other activities in Baie-Saint-Paul?

Absolutely. Baie-Saint-Paul is a vibrant town with a rich architectural heritage, perfect for cultural stops. The Boisé du Quai nature park offers hiking trails and opportunities for swimming. Additionally, the nearby Isle-aux-Coudres, accessible by ferry, provides more cycling routes and scenery, making it ideal for a multi-day exploration.
